Output 91e83d40dbde70973710cd9eb59aac4077a75d50bf6270a7e5a8617b53edbc7e:2

value
10340998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b4c3bb8d10f7366d8deaa0f0a3bf6d79ebc4b0 OP_EQUAL
address
3CRPXjMs7LWq9KKFopyqwywMbHdLwjtu4r
transaction
91e83d40dbde70973710cd9eb59aac4077a75d50bf6270a7e5a8617b53edbc7e
spent
true